Introduction to MAX2837ETM

The MAX2837ETM is a state-of-the-art integrated circuit designed for a variety of applications in the world of RF transceivers. Its multi-functional capabilities and high-performance features make it an ideal choice for engineers and developers in industries such as telecommunications, automotive, and consumer electronics. Designed to meet the rigorous demands of modern wireless standards, MAX2837ETM allows for seamless integration into various systems, providing a reliable and powerful solution.

Types of MAX2837ETM Applications

The versatility of the MAX2837ETM is reflected in its broad range of applications. Below are the key types:

  • Wireless Communication: Ideal for mobile communication devices, providing reliable signal processing.
  • Automotive Systems: Enhances connectivity features in vehicles, supporting applications like car-to-car communication.
  • Consumer Electronics: Used in devices such as smartphones, tablets, and wearable technology to improve performance.
  • Internet of Things (IoT): Suitable for developing IoT devices that require efficient RF transmission and reception capabilities.

Function, Feature, and Design of MAX2837ETM

The MAX2837ETM boasts a diverse range of features designed to enhance its functionality:

  • High-Frequency Operation: Supports frequencies up to 5.8 GHz, making it suitable for various high-demand applications.
  • Low Power Consumption: Efficient power management ensures longer operational times for battery-powered devices.
  • Integrated Circuits: Combines multiple functionalities into a single chip, minimizing the need for extra components.
  • Compact Form Factor: The small package size allows easy integration into tight spaces of modern electronics.
  • Programmable Settings: Users can fine-tune parameters for optimized performance tailored to specific use cases.
